The Takht Harmandir is the second-most important gurudwara (sikh temple) of the whole India. It was built by Guru Gobind Singh, the 10th guru of the Sikhs.

Shershah Masjid is the oldest mosque in Patna and was built by the Afghan ruler Sher Shah, who defeated the Mughal Emperor Humanyun.

Bodhgaya is a place sacred to all Buddhist people : Siddhartha, attained enlightenment and became Buddha (the enlightened) at Bodhgaya, making it one of the four holiest sites for Buddhism.

Here one can admire the remains of the 80 pillared hall which not only impressed Magasthenese the most but also continue to impress architects even today.

Other places of interest in Patna include the Khuda Baksh Oriental Library, famous for its rare Arabic and Persian manuscripts, rich paintings and numerous volumes of rare books
